Readability Tips for Real-World Use
While Heros Racing is visually striking, it's important to consider its use in different contexts. For small stickers or printed cards, I recommend testing the font at various sizes to ensure it remains readable. When using it on cutting machines like Cricut or Silhouette, I’ve found that a slightly heavier weight helps prevent the text from appearing too thin or delicate.
For longer text, such as descriptions on product listings or packaging, I suggest pairing Heros Racing with a simpler sans serif or serif font to maintain legibility and avoid overwhelming the reader.
Font Pairing and Stylistic Considerations
Heros Racing pairs beautifully with a range of other fonts. For a clean and modern look, I often pair it with a minimalist sans serif like Helvetica or Arial. If I want to add a bit of elegance, I’ll go with a simple serif font like Georgia or Garamond. For more creative projects, combining it with a handwritten or script font can add a unique flair that stands out.
It's also worth checking what styles, alternates, ligatures, and weights come with the font. Some versions may include swashes or special characters that can enhance your designs further. Make sure to review the file formats and multilingual support if you're planning to use it for international markets or digital downloads.
